The Great British Fry up.

The Fry Up is an established part of British food. Growing up this was our Saturday dinner, unless Christmas fell on a Saturday you knew what you would be eating. These days we have it far less often and cooking in oil has replaced cooking with lard.

So what you need:
Sausages. (plain pork ones or any other version you fancy, just remember to buy them.)
Eggs.
Bacon. (Back bacon or streeky bacon, smoked or unsmoked.)
Button mushrooms. (sliced in half.)
All these are shallow fried so you need at least 2 frying pans on the go. I fry the sausages in one pan and once they are cooked fry the mushrooms in it while in the other pan I cook the bacon first and then the eggs.

Also needed:
1 tin of chopped tomatoes.
1 tin of baked bean or spaggetti (I did spaggetti today.) or both depending on how you feel.
(These are just chucked in a bowl and warmed up in the microwave because it's easier.)

Extra things you can have are:
Black Pudding or blood pudding. (Same thing, different names.)
Fried Bread. (Take a slice of bread, cut it in half and shallow fry it until it browns. Do this before the rest and leave on a plate to get crunchy as it cools.)
Hash Browns. (This is a recent addition and not really part of a traditional British Fry Up.)
Tomato ketchup or Brown sauce.

This food isn't classed as healthy but it's tasty. You can make it a bit more healthy by grilling the sausage and bacon and having the eggs poached or scrambled but in moderation it's not going to hurt to fry it all.
